About This Game

Meow Defence War is a pixel-art physics-based strategy game. Your mission is to build defensive fortifications using different materials, ensuring Meow survives the various attacks from the mice and achieving higher scores.

Use your wit and basic physics knowledge to build the most ingenious defenses with limited funds, resisting the mice's attacks and other threats. Utilize the environment and available materials to achieve victory. Failure is not a problem; you can quickly retry and adjust, or continuously challenge for higher scores.

Realistic Physics Simulation

Building materials, projectiles, and Meow all have realistic physics effects, with damage calculated based on physical impact force. Rolling, bouncing, and squeezing all pose threats to materials and Meow. These physics effects can also be used strategically; a smaller impact angle reduces damage, while materials that directly block projectiles will suffer greater damage. By controlling the angle and position of materials, you can even deflect projectiles with minimal damage.

Multiple Materials and Threats

Materials: There are four types of materials: wood, stone, iron, and bubbles. Each material has unique characteristics and different prices. Bubble-type materials are the cheapest but fragile; however, they can levitate and sometimes have unexpected effects. Iron materials are the most expensive and strongest, but beware of the threat from electric projectiles.

Projectiles: There are 8 types of projectiles, each with different effects. Some ignite wood, some have excessive weight, some delay explosions, and some attract objects. Projectiles can be launched by the mouse and may also be distributed in the air.

Environment: Sometimes you'll even have to deal with gaps in the terrain; remember not to let your cat fall into the water.

Mouse Attack Strategy: Mouse attack the weakest points in the defenses. They always choose the least obstructed parabolic trajectory, meaning the area with the fewest materials. However, mice don't have very good eyesight, so you can try to deceive them using materials; sometimes what seems weak is actually the strongest.

Score Leaderboard

Spending less money, having more health remaining for your cat, or adding a random projectile can all lead to higher scores. Each level has its own score leaderboard, allowing you to continuously challenge for higher scores.

In addition to scores, the layout of your character's building within each level will be simultaneously uploaded to the leaderboard. Your clever layout will be showcased to all players, or you can view other players' layouts for inspiration.

Multiple Gameplay Modes

Counterattack Mode: Meow Meow has captured the turret! In this mode, you can control the turret to try and destroy the defenses you've built.

Random Challenge Mode: New levels are randomly generated from existing levels. Try facing new challenges in this mode.

Hotseat Battle Mode: Allows two players to play offline simultaneously. One player builds the layout, while the other controls the turret to try and destroy it.
